Let Her Decide
As little as your daughter is she could already have a favourite show or a favourite toy. And so when it comes to dressing up you should also make her exercise her decision making skills. You can simply ask her what she wants to wear. But make it easier for her by presenting her with 2 to 3 choices only. Otherwise she would be overwhelmed by too many choices. After the dress, you can let her choose the hair accessory she wants to wear with the dress. With her decision already made, what you can do is lay it neatly ready for the next day. This way, she would be able to dress herself up in the morning without much delay.
Provide an Easy to Follow Guide
You also have to teach your daughter logic even if it only pertains to dressing up. For instance, she should know that she should start with putting on some underwear and then dress. Then she can put on her socks and her shoes. She can end by putting on some hair accessory.
You have to have a reminder for her to master the order though. To do this, you can make a poster where this is illustrated. You can draw pictures of the activity. But if you are not that good in drawing, you can easily take some snaps and paste it in the poster. Post it in a spot in the room she would easily see. This would make it easier for her to follow your illustration.
Be There to Guide Her
While she is just starting to learn how to dress herself, you should make her prepare earlier so there would be more time for her to get dressed. Otherwise, both of you would be rushing. This way too you would not have to step in right away when your daughter is not getting it right yet. You would have the luxury of giving her time to learn how to get dressed by herself.
Start with Something Easy
When you start making her dress by herself, you should also make it easier for her. For instance, you should start with slip on pants with elastic waist bands instead of clothing with zippers, buttons and snaps. Instead of complicated hair clips, you can let her use headbands. And then you can let her practice with Velcro straps instead of shoelaces.
Be Gentle with Criticism
Of course, your daughter would not perfect everything right away. But when you make some criticisms you should be gentle. Make sure to praise her for the correct things she has done. And then gently show her how to do the things she did not do correctly.
This may only seem to be a simple exercise. But learning how to get dressed by herself is a very big step and achievement for your daughter. When she achieves it she also becomes more confident about herself.
